Somerville to review crosswalks on Walnut and Wigglesworth near Winter Hill School; staff cite competing priorities and technical impediments
Summary
An order asking engineering and mobility to install crosswalks near Winter Hill Community Innovation School prompted staff to say Walnut Street appears more warranted than Wigglesworth and to note technical constraints (curb ramps, poles, drainage). An order from Councilors Klingen, McLaughlin, Wilson and Strezzo asked city staff to collaborate on installing crosswalks across Walnut Street and Wigglesworth Street to protect students and families walking to Winter Hill Community Innovation School.
